Hybrid electrochemical methods and systems for syngas production
By using a combined MCFC and SOEC system to electrolyze flue gas to produce syngas, the problems of energy-intensive and high pollutant emissions in existing syngas production have been solved, achieving more energy-efficient and environmentally friendly syngas production.

Existing syngas production methods are energy-intensive and generate large amounts of pollutants and greenhouse gases, necessitating a more energy-efficient and environmentally friendly production method.
A combined system of molten carbonate fuel cell (MCFC) and solid oxide electrolyzer (SOEC) is used to produce carbon monoxide and hydrogen by electrolyzing carbon dioxide and steam in flue gas. The synthesis gas generation process is optimized by combining a methanation reactor and a gasifier.
It reduces energy consumption and pollutant emissions, providing a more environmentally friendly method for producing syngas that can efficiently generate carbon monoxide and hydrogen.
